3302c1ba99 Identify all accesses to the Primary System Area
Whenever a field was added to the end of the Primary System Area (PSA)
record, the offsets of all other fields would change. When reversing NK
version 02.27, I noticed that 32 bytes had been added to the end of the
PSA between 02.27 and 02.28. To build a byte-perfect 02.27, all
references to PSA fields must therefore use the record definition in
NKPublic.s instead of a numeric offset.

In this commit, all PSA references are identified by field name (_FFF if
the field has not yet been reversed).

4c0e5221f1 Remove unnecessary static branch hints
These + and - characters in a branch mnemonic can cause the assembler to
produce conditional branch instructions with that hint the branch
predictor. The default for forward branches is -, and for backward
branches is +. If a mnemonic is issued with the opposite sign, then bit
10 of the instruction (the LSB of the BO field) is set.

My long-retired "ppcdisasm" script inserted these hints unconditionally,
despite 98% of them not being required. The code is much cleaner now.

I read in some old MPW release notes that PPCAsm and PPCLink together
exhibit a quirk when linking conditional branches to imported symbols.
PPCAsm always assembles these conditional branches as if they were
forward branches (that is, a + hint will always set the hint bit, and a
- hint will never). I hoped to use this property to divine whether the
NanoKernel was linked from one or many assembly files, but I was
frustrated by the lack of conditional branches between files.
